Handover for the weekly eng sync: Greenloop plant-watering scheduler moves from Ona to Felix this sprint. Cron-based schedules migrated to the new event queue; drip-zone overrides work, but the frost-delay rule still double-fires on the Thistledown greenhouse cluster. Fix is sketched in branch ona/frost-dedupe. Sensor calibration docs live in the team wiki. Felix will need access to the scheduler's secrets vault to rotate the pump-controller credentials, so the recovery passphrase for that vault follows immediately below.

unlock words, yawig-kagef: gordor-holvan-ulaael-pramir-ulaiel-tamdor

Q2 Planning Note — Customer Concentration

Board: quick flag before the full deck lands. Brindlewood Logistics now accounts for just under 41% of revenue, up from 33% a year ago. Great customer, obviously, but that's a lot of eggs in one basket. We're pushing harder into the mid-market via the Coppice channel and trimming Brindlewood-specific discounts at renewal. Targets and timelines are in the appendix. Our plan to rebalance the book is captured in the confidential note below.

board note of kaduf-tajep: Project Norael slips by a full year because of the audit delay.

**Badge Migration — Reception Brief**

From Monday, Eastgale House moves to the Keylark badge system. Old grey cards stop working at 09:00. Issue blue replacement cards at the front desk; collect and bin the grey ones. Expect queues the first morning. If the enrolment station is down, admit staff manually after checking the roster, using the override code below.

turnstile pass: bdg-R-53

## Hot-reload procedure — Kestrelbox

Kestrelbox watches its config directory and reloads within five seconds of a write, without restarting workers. Support should verify the reload log line before declaring a change applied; partial writes are rejected atomically. The reloadable configuration values currently in effect are the following.

deployment values, bahap-bahip:
[eliath]
team = gorius
access_code = ac_9ce55b
owner = holion.eliius
host = eliath.nelvrohq.internal
port = 8443
peer = kaswyn.merlaqlabs.test
salt = 01afd960
pin = 5193